1999 Chrysler 300M review from North America
"Had the potential to be a real feat of engineering"
What things have gone wrong with the car?
- A/C stopped blowing cool air, A/C compressor clutch loads the engine down when switching.
- Driver side rear door window motor non operational.
- Buzzing from the dashboard front speaker.
- Audible tapping noise when the engine is started from cold, does not reoccur after subsequent warm starts.
General comments?
The car handles extremely well, with lots of power on tap for high speed maneuvering. I did have problems with traction control going up a snow covered hill in March with street tires, however, the antilock brakes worked as expected. Tire noise is high, probably due to the General Exclaim tires that replaced the OE ones, but this probably also accounts for the superb handling.
Lots of room in the trunk, and with the seats folded down in the rear, one could easily place a 60"x30" object in the rear of the car with no problem.
Sunroof is very nice, and works well.
Interior is well laid out, electric heated leather seats are still in excellent shape after 7 years, and the rear climate control vents are a luxurious touch.
This car was originally designed for the European market, but was also popular here as well (and I did see a number of them in the Baltic states and in Russia).
